2. Blockchain: Backbone for Secure Transaction
Blockchain is not just limited to bitcoin and cryptocurrencies. It is one of the new banking technology innovations. One of the major benefits is fraud prevention. Blockchain makes it almost impossible for any unethical activity to go unnoticed. One of the primary reasons for it becoming one of the leading banking technology trends is its immutable ledger. It assures that all the transactions are recorded, they are safe, and are also validated. Banks have the upper hand in identifying any anomalies in real-time. This helps in maintaining transparency, security, and trust.
Blockchain also allows doing the KYC process. Banks can safely store and exchange information about client identification with other banks. KYC data can be accessed from a shared and safe blockchain platform without customer involvement. Customers won’t have to repeat the KYC process every time they interact with a new bank.

3. Biometric Authentication for Improved Safeguarding
Robust security is one of the basic requirements. Hence, it is among the top banking technology trends. With banking software, it is not just the user’s information but the money involved with all their financial details. Having data or security leaks with banking apps will be a massive disaster.
Biometric authentication methods were adopted to solve this challenge. Facial recognition, fingerprint scanning, and voice authentication must be integrated. These can increase security and deliver a flawless user experience. Passwords or pins can be replicated or hacked but it is difficult with biometric credentials reducing the risk of fraud.

7. Hyper personalized Banking: Meeting User Expectations
Hyper-personalization is not just limited to meeting user needs and knowing your customers (KYC). This involves creating a detailed profile of every client by evaluating little things like purchases, social media, support tickets, and spending habits. Understanding the client and their purchase patterns is one thing but using it to take it to the next level is what helps.
For example, if a customer is a frequent traveler to foreign countries, the banking technology can offer international credit card options or travel insurance. Customers didn’t even know they needed these services before you approached.

9. RegTech: Compliance with Automation
Regulatory technology in banking uses machine learning, AI, and data analytics to allow financial institutions to cope with regulatory needs. AI-powered tools are capable of monitoring transactions in real-time. Hence, it can easily find out money laundering activities.

11. Robo Advisors: Automating Investment Strategies
AI algorithms are used by robo-advisors to provide automated investment advice. The broader audience can have easy access to wealth management tips. It is one of the growing banking trends. Its ability to analyze market trends and customers’ risk profiles is truly what sets it apart. This helps in recommending personalized investment portfolios.
